– Human Hermaphrodite -Doña Phicenta Thragiella De Thrul - The Fictionaut (New Player) ??? - lookus b. (New Player) ??? - The Hermit Legend Game Summary for Sunday Evening (12/08/2019): It is now 26
days into the adventure (since setting off in the Belle Venture), and 6:00 am
on day 20 on the isle. It is now August
19 th . It is now early
morning and the party discusses what course of action to take next while at the
camp, near the riverbank and hidden from view of the river docks manned by the
mongrelmen when a familiar voice is heard calling out to them from the
riverbank. Coal, heads
towards the sound and sees that it is Quintolos, still in his transformed state
with slimy mucus covered skin and gills on his throat. Quintolos, tells
the party that there is in fact another way into the Forbidden City. Sheila, tries a
Remove Curse spell on Quintolos to remove his affliction but it does not work. Sheila, also
heals the wounds of Grax and Rowan with Cure Light & Cure Serious Wounds
spells. Quintolos, tells
them to travel along the base of the plateau, going around north westerly until
they reach a river being fed by a huge 3,000 ft tall waterfall. It is here that
Quintolos tells them to wait for him before crossing, so he can point the way
farther. The party
travels without incident to the spot indicated and wait for Quintolos to
arrive. When he does he
again points out where exactly to keep heading once on the other side of the
river. Cassandra, uses
her broom and ring of invisibility to fly over each member of the party one at
a time until everyone is on the opposite side. Briefly, having a scare when an
adult Wyvern was seen to fly down the river looking for a meal to scoop from
it. The Wyvern pays the group not mention. Quintolos, tells
the party that short, Grippli frogmen, should likely appear at some point along
the path they are to take and guide them the rest of the way. Once near the
entrance, the Grippli, departs and leaves the party on their own to continue. After traveling
over 200 feet inside the hidden cavern passage they arrive inside a natural
cavern area. Area
Description: This chamber is a large natural
cavern, with a large pool filling most of it. Along the east
wall is a 5 foot wide ledge, running around the edge of the pool.
The ledge ends in a small alcove. The walls of the
alcove are worked with carvings of snakes and men in a pastoral
scene and at its back stands a large statue of a
snake-bodied, six-armed woman. Flanking it are 2 charcoal braziers
mounted on tripods. These cast a dim light throughout
the room. Three canoes are beached in the alcove. The water
appears calm and undisturbed. The party sees
that the one canoe closest to them is in several pieces sitting mainly on the
bank, (of which Balen pulls it off the bank and down into the tunnel they came
in from), while the other two, on the other side where the alcove is, are
partially in the water and appear intact. Grax, leads the
party heading along the ledge and goes for the boats checking for a trap but
does not find one. The boats are
pulled fully into the water and half the party gets into each boat. Trying to
determine the water’s depth, they stick an oar, which is 10 feet long, straight
down but can not feel it hit bottom. They then row
eastward through a narrow gap then turn north easterly into one of two passages
when rippling in the water is noticed coming towards the boat. It can now be
seen that it is a Crododile! (A Surprise roll was made but it failed so it
could not try to capsize the boat!) And that ends
